Transaction 4e63549c3b78265cc904f23db90fd855c03e4e74bd77510f847c3a28ae280c57

1 Input
2 Outputs
  • 4e63549c3b78265cc904f23db90fd855c03e4e74bd77510f847c3a28ae280c57:0
  • value  3767267
    address  143fFe2KEctFC24DeD9m9WSjmDwaRpHjci
  • 4e63549c3b78265cc904f23db90fd855c03e4e74bd77510f847c3a28ae280c57:1
  • value  30736644
    address  1Kwf1s7jXj7Tawgf3jLmiRd4rc7766FPPg